John Orndoff, age 54 of Clairton, passed away on Thursday, February 20, 2020 in Baldwin Health Center. Born January 30, 1966 in McKeesport, he was a son of the late Wayne and Irene (Vasilchak) Orndoff. A member of Ascension of Our Lord Byzantine Catholic Church in Clairton, John is survived by his siblings Barbara Orndoff of Parma, OH and David Orndoff of Clairton.

Catherine Ann Skrtic, 70, of Lawrence, Kan., formerly of McKeesport, died Monday, Feb. 17, 2020. She was born in McKeesport on Feb. 8, 1950 and is the daughter of the late Paul G. and Caroline D’Annunzio Skrtic. Catherine graduated from Mon Valley High School in West Mifflin in 1969 and was employed for 20 years at the Eldridge Hotel in Lawrence, Kan., until her retirement in 2012. She was a member of the Natural Ties student organization at the University of Kansas, a member of the THRIL Horseback Riding Club and a member of St. Eugene Church of St. Mark Parish in Liberty Borough and the former St. Joseph Church in Port Vue.

George W. Blasko, age 89, of North Huntingdon Township, passed away Tuesday, February 18, 2020. He was born February 3, 1931 in Pittsburgh, a son of the late Andrew and Helen Blasko. He was a member of the Church of the Immaculate Conception in Irwin, the Irwin Moose for over 52 years, and the Police Rod & Gun Club in New Alexandra. He worked for over 37 years at Penn State Tool and Die in Irwin before retiring. He loved the outdoors, especially hunting and fishing at the camp in Bedford. In addition to his parents, he is preceded in death by his brothers Thomas and Andrew Blasko.

Caroline M. Moranelli, 87, of Glassport died Feb. 19, 2020. She is the daughter of the late Antonio and Mary (Tavalaro) Moranelli and is survived by her nieces Barbara Moranelli, with whom she resided, and Lisa Moranelli; also n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by sisters Catherine Concel and Minnie Ponzo; brothers Frank Moranelli, Nick "Mutt" Moranelli and Ralph "Rossi" Moranelli and nephew James Ponzo, her longtime caretaker. Caroline worked at Immels, GC Murphy Company, Pater's Pharmacy and retired from Rite Aid in Glassport; was a graduate from St. Peters High School and was a member of Queen of the Rosary Parish. Friends received Wojciechowski Funeral Home, Glassport on Sat. from 10:00 am to 11:00 am, at which time a funeral mass will be held at Queen of the Rosary with Father Wojcicki. Inurnment following New St. Joseph Cemetery. The family would like to thank the wonderful staff at Golden Heights Person Care, Walden's View Personal Care and especially Heritage Hospice for taking such good care of their aunt.

Vernell J. Stewart, 78, was born April 24, 1941 in McKeesport, Pennsylvania, daughter of the late William and Xnola West; departed this life peacefully on Saturday, February 15, 2020 in Austell, Georgia. She was also preceded in death by her husband, John Stewart, brother, Larry Roy West and grandchild Jayemond Bailey.
Vernell graduated from McKeesport High School. She attended CCAC and later became a certified nursing assistant. She worked at UPMC McKeesport Hospital for 32 years until she retired. She met her husband; the late John Stewart and they were married for over 40 years.
Vernell accepted Christ at an early age. She was a faithful member of Petra International Ministries until she moved to Georgia. Vernell served in several capacities, she was a member of the Adult Choir and Usher Board. She loved to read. Her favorite pass time was doing word puzzles.

Vesta Y. Bivins, 76 years old of North Versailles, was born October 6, 1943 in Clairton, Pennsylvania, daughter of the late Cleavester and Madge Lee Phillips. She departed this life on February 13, 2020 in Forbes Hospital and was also preceded in death by her son Tiron Bivins.
Vesta was a Duquesne High School graduate. She was a Staff Secretary for Westinghouse, and later worked as a Case Coordinator for Children & Youth Services. She met Frank Bivins and they were married for over 52 years.

Shirley Mae Cleveland-Montgomery, 84, died Feb. 14, 2020 in McKeesport. She was born Dec. 24, 1935, in Pittsburgh to Katherine Cleveland (Herrer) and Odell Cleveland. She spent her childhood years growing up on Hosier Street in Homestead as well as on the family farm in Homeville with her brothers Odell & Calvin Cleveland.
She always talked about her family horse “Harry”. Harry was in charge of farm chores as well as giving the children rides around the farm. She also had a pet pig but learned quickly that pigs are not pets. Thanksgiving that year was a sad affair.
Through the years, she resided in several places Chicago, IL., Homewood, PA, East Liberty, PA, but returned to Homestead, PA. She worked several manufacturing jobs while in Chicago before returning to Homestead to help her brother Calvin run the family-owned bar, “Cleveland Grill.”

Virginia M. Hess, age 90, of White Oak, died February 19, 2020. She was born in McKeesport on August 14,1929 and is the daughter of the late Joseph and Elizabeth Mima Godek.
Virginia graduated from McKeesport High School in 1947 and the McKeesport Hospital School of Nursing in 1950. She was a retired Registered Nurse for UPMC McKeesport for many years and later a private duty nurse. She was a member of the former St. Mary’s Czestochowa Church and currently a member of Mary, Mother of God Parish.
